Why AI-Powered SEO Is Different
AI-powered SEO is not about using AI to write blog posts faster. It is about using machine intelligence to understand your buyers’ entire search landscape — the questions they ask at every stage of the buying cycle, the terminology they use in technical evaluations, the concerns they research before shortlisting vendors — and building a content ecosystem that captures every relevant intent signal.
The Technical SEO Stack for Enterprise Buyers
Semantic Search Architecture: Modern search engines do not just match keywords — they understand meaning, context, and buyer intent. Your content needs to be structured around semantic clusters that demonstrate deep expertise across every topic relevant to your buyer’s decision-making process.
Technical Content at Scale: Enterprise buyers validate their choices with technical depth. AI systems can now produce technically accurate, deeply researched content across your entire topic graph — from high-level executive summaries to detailed technical specifications — at a pace no human team can match.
Intent-Driven Content Architecture: Map your content to the buyer’s journey — awareness, consideration, evaluation, decision — and ensure you have content assets that capture intent signals at every stage. This is how you build compounding organic traffic that converts.
